#26043a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#26043a is composed of 14.9% red, 1.6%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.5% cyan, 93.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 77.3% black. It has a hue angle of 277.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 12.2%. #26043a color hex could be obtained by blending #4c0874 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#26043a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f9f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#26043a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1f1e20 is the less saturated color, while #27023c is the most saturated one.
